Peanut oil has a very high smoke point at 450 degrees. It has a slightly nutty taste, though many consider it neutral. High oleic sunflower oil has a smoke point of 440°f. However, the sunflower oils with a smoke point of just 225°f are not suitable for frying fish. Vegetable, canola, and grapeseed oil are widely considered the best choices. The downside to peanut oil is the high saturated fat content. The most common choice of oil for frying fish is sunflower oil. The best oils to use for deep frying fish are those with high smoke points, meaning they can withstand the heat of the fryer without burning.
